A Social Life

Participating in shared activities and engaging with their peers socially are the main reasons seniors choose to move to Heritage Pointe.  Every day our event calendar is full. This gives seniors lots of opportunities to stay active and socialize within the community. Research has shown that socializing with friends improves your health, including physical and emotional wellness.  After the pandemic, its more clear than ever the toll of isolation. At Heritage Pointe, a team of Activities staff plan each week full of diverse and entertaining programs. Best of all, we encourage residents to participate and even lead new activities.

Nutritional Dining

Excellent and delicious nutrition should be a part of every seniors’ daily experience. Heritage Pointe offers a rotating menu, filled with dishes that are flavorful, nutritious, and a delight to eat. We can accommodate specialty diets, including low-sodium, Kosher, heart-healthy, and pureed diets. Residents enjoy three meals a day in the main Dining Room, where wait staff offer daily specials, personalized service, and restaurant-style dining.

On-site Fitness and Physical Therapy

A senior’s mobility is often linked to their physical and emotional wellbeing. A senior may become depressed or anxious after a recent fall or injury. Heritage Pointe offers multiple daily fitness classes, led by accredited personal trainers, group walks, a personalized fitness plan, and scheduled assistance if requested. There is also a physical therapist on site if needed, and the senior-friendly fitness center promotes a healthy lifestyle for all residents.

Transportation Services

While many senior communities, including Heritage Pointe, have everything on-site, there are times when residents want to run outside errands. Having a car is not needed, and most seniors can stop worrying that they will miss having one. But many freedoms come with senior living, not to mention freedom from car insurance and monthly payments! Heritage Pointe has a weekly transportation schedule, as well as a fleet of bus/van/car options for residents. Trips to doctor offices, banks, the mall, the drugstore, and more are available every week for free. Volunteers are also available to help residents navigate medical buildings to get you where you need to go. Weekly outings to restaurants, concerts, and events add to the social atmosphere of a lively senior community.

Retirement and Inflation

The cost of goods and services to maintain a senior’s home and healthy lifestyle continue to climb. Now, more than ever, it is important to secure a safe and comfortable home for a senior to age in place. Many seniors live in too-large homes with stairs, steps, thick rugs, or other potential fall risks. Sadly, some seniors move to a retirement community after a recent fall or other injury. The best time for seniors to decide where to live is when the decision is their choice, and at their timing. Heritage Pointe is a rental community, so there is no costly buy-in like other communities. The monthly rent includes all utilities, phone, cable, transportation, Wi-Fi, emergency alert system, weekly housekeeping and linen services, and three kosher meals served daily.
